About Knife Standards RR Standard (+) Silver+Gold Folding Knife – 4" MagnaCut Clip Point Blade, Titanium Frame, Carbon Fiber Inlays, Ceramic Bearings

The Knife Standards RR Standard (+) Silver+Gold is the upgraded evolution of the original RR Standard—the design that started it all. Dedicated to the maker’s father, this limited-production folder bridges collectible craftsmanship with hard-use functionality.

At its core is a 4" CPM MagnaCut blade with a compound hollow grind and belt satin finish, hardened to 63–64 HRC for elite edge retention, toughness, and corrosion resistance. Thin behind the edge yet reinforced for strength, the clip point blade balances slicing precision with durability.

The frame is built from 6AL-4V titanium, chamfered for comfort and milled internally for weight reduction. Fat Carbon fiber inlays and the signature Knife Standards milling pattern enhance both grip and aesthetics. Action is powered by ceramic bearings and a ceramic detent, providing glassy-smooth deployment via dual thumb studs.

Every detail is refined: custom square pivot hardware with RR initials, all T8 screws, and a reversible milled titanium pocket clip (with optional wire clip) for versatile carry. Each knife is individually numbered, underscoring its limited run.

The RR Standard (+) Silver+Gold represents the culmination of years of design, refinement, and dedication—an EDC that is as much a collector’s piece as it is a high-performance cutting tool.


Specifications Table

Specification Detail
Model RR Standard (+) Silver+Gold
Designer ATR (Knife Standards)
Blade Steel CPM MagnaCut
Hardness (HRC) 63–64
Blade Style Clip point
Blade Grind Compound hollow
Blade Finish Belt satin
Blade Length 4" (101.9 mm)
Cutting Edge 3.46" (88 mm)
Blade Thickness 0.14" (3.8 mm)
Handle Material 6AL-4V titanium with Fat Carbon fiber inlays
Handle Length 4.8" (122.5 mm)
Handle Height 1.18" (30 mm)
Handle Width 0.54" (13.8 mm)
Overall Length 8.83" (224.4 mm)
Weight 5 oz (142 g)
Locking Mechanism Frame lock / bolster lock
Pivot Captive custom square pivot (T8) with RR initials
Hardware T8 screws
Bearings Ceramic ball bearings
Detent Ceramic
Pocket Clip Reversible milled titanium + wire clip option
Opening Method Dual thumb studs
Country of Origin China
Production Individually numbered, limited run
